Why
The Southern Lights were caused by a recent solar event where the sun's charge interacted with Earth's magnetic field and was channeled to the poles.

Astronauts aboard spacecraft and the International Space Station occasionally witness auroras from above, especially during solar storms when the intensity pushes auroras to higher latitudes making them more visible.
